The Role of Cassette Oil Seals in Mechanical Systems
In the realm of mechanical engineering, the importance of sealing solutions cannot be overstated. Among the numerous types of seals available, cassette oil seals have gained considerable attention due to their efficiency and reliability in preventing lubricant leakage and contamination. In this article, we will delve into the characteristics, advantages, applications, and maintenance of cassette oil seals.
What is a Cassette Oil Seal?
A cassette oil seal is a specific type of sealing device designed to retain oil or fluid within a mechanical assembly while preventing external contaminants from entering. Typically constructed from durable materials such as rubber or plastic, these seals possess a cylindrical shape that houses a specialized sealing lip. This lip makes contact with the shaft or surface it is designed to protect, creating a barrier against oil leakage.
Key Features and Advantages
1. Design Efficiency One of the most significant features of cassette oil seals is their compact design. They are relatively easy to install and remove, making them suitable for various applications without requiring major alterations to the machinery.
2. Enhanced Durability High-quality cassette oil seals are engineered to withstand harsh operating conditions, including temperature fluctuations, pressure changes, and exposure to chemicals. This robustness extends the lifespan of both the seal and the equipment it protects.
3. Reduced Maintenance Costs By effectively preventing oil leaks, cassette oil seals contribute to lower maintenance costs. Equipment that operates with intact seals experiences fewer breakdowns, thus reducing both downtime and repair expenses.
4. Versatility Cassette oil seals can be used in a multitude of applications, from automotive engines to industrial machinery. Their adaptability makes them a preferred choice across various sectors.
Applications in Industries
Cassette oil seals are widely utilized in several industries, showcasing their versatility and effectiveness. In the automotive sector, they play a pivotal role in engine components, including crankshafts and camshafts, where they help maintain the integrity of the lubricating system. In industrial machinery, these seals are employed in gearboxes, pumps, and motors, where they prevent oil spillage and contamination.
Moreover, cassette oil seals are increasingly finding applications in agricultural machinery, aerospace technology, and household appliances. Their ability to perform in extreme conditions without compromising their sealing capabilities makes them invaluable in today’s mechanical systems.
Maintenance of Cassette Oil Seals
To ensure their longevity and effectiveness, regular inspections of cassette oil seals are essential. Technicians should look for signs of wear, such as cracks, deformation, or oil leakage. If any issues are identified, it is critical to replace the seals promptly to avoid potential damage to the machinery.
Furthermore, proper installation is crucial. Incorrect fitting can lead to premature failure, resulting in leaks and decreased efficiency. Adhering to the manufacturer's guidelines during the replacement process helps maintain optimal performance.
